ALBUM REVIEW: In My Arms by BaDow

Recently, I was contacted by the band BaDow, a three piece groove rock band from the Isle of Wight, just a bit south of Hampshire consisting of  Bradley McGinty - Bass, Jodie Amos - Drums/Lead Vocal, Sam Morris - Guitar. Being unaware of the local scene in Britain, I was rather excited to listen to their release, Up In Arms, they had put out. Here's what I have to say about it after giving it a listen.
 I was pleasantly surprised at what I heard, what sounded like a classic sounding American band. I picked up a lot of vibes from the 60's and 70's. This band is currently unsigned, though I gather looking for a label which I hope they find, as they bring something fresh to a scene that is somewhat cluttered with bands that do the same thing over and over again; whether that be shoegaze, hardcore, or metal. Not putting those things down, as they are primarily what I listen to, but it makes for something nice when you hear a record that does something unique.
  Production and sound wise this record is very good, with some really very strong riffs, leads and some really quick, but very nice, solos. The guitar effects that are used also, primarily I believe drive and distortion, really make for a very classic sounding record. The drums and bass also follow up with some very good tone, beat and rhythm. Vocally, this release is also very strong with powerful, bluesy-sounding vocals. Production wise this record is also well produced and it shows how much time and effort was put into the record, as there aren't any sound hiccups or anything noticeable.
 I can't find any REAL complaints about this record, its genuine, and a solid release from a band I hope to see succeed with their musical careers, hopefully they can find some success in the states with at least a few people after they read this. Finally, after a listen, I can safely give this record a solid 8/10, which is well earned from BaDow.

The album will be available on the 20th of June.
